The previous article explained how to adapt to impossible terrains. This one asks a different and deeper question: are these difficult terrains really fair? Or do certain player profiles — through their technique, their experience, or their psychology — find a structural advantage in them that the others don't even perceive? The answer, backed by physics and sports psychology, is clear: tricky terrains aren't neutral. The direct answer — it is not chance

🔍 ANALYSIS Tricky grounds create reproducible structural advantages Let's start by demolishing the idea that difficult grounds are "fair because both teams play on them". It is true in absolute terms — both teams face the same surface. But the effects of this ground vary radically depending on the playing style, the technique mastered, the experience accumulated and the mental state of each player.

Concrete example: a very stony ground. Two teams play on it. One consists of a powerful direct-hit shooter and a pointer who plays rolled points. The other has a lofted pointer and a rafle shooter. On this stony ground, the second team is objectively advantaged : the lofted points pass over the stones, the rafle uses them as guides. The rolled points and the direct-hit shooting of the first team are more disturbed by the stones. It is not luck — it is physics.

This advantage is structural : it exists independently of the individual technical level of the players. An average lofted pointer can beat an excellent rolled pointer on a stony ground simply because their technique is better suited to the conditions. 🎙️ Paquita on "fair" grounds "We often hear 'it's the same ground for everyone, so it's fair'. That is a reasoning error. A muddy ground is fair in the same way that a swimming race in a pool half-filled with mud would be fair — technically both swimmers have the same conditions, but the swimmer who learned to swim in murky water has a real advantage over the one who has only ever swum in perfect pools. The difficult ground is the true leveler — it levels down those who have never practiced on it and levels up those who have made it their playing ground." — Paquita

The 7 profiles that benefit from tricky grounds

1 The lofted pointer — an advantage on any uneven ground The lofted point (high trajectory, strong-angle landing) makes the boule "fly" above the surface irregularities. On a stony, bumpy or root-filled ground, the boule passes over the obstacles instead of interacting with them. The rolled pointer, on the other hand, sends the boule skimming along the ground over the whole trajectory — every stone, every bump is a potential disturber. On a perfect ground, both techniques are equivalent. On a difficult ground, the lofted point dominates. → Systematic advantage on: stony, bumpy, root-filled ground, tall grass 2 The rafle player — stones as guides, not as obstacles The rafle shooter sends the boule rolling up to the target. On a stony ground, a first reflex would be to think that the stones hinder the rafle as much as the rolled point. That is wrong. The rafle, slower and lower than the direct-hit shot, "navigates" between the stones — the small obstacles guide it rather than deflecting it abruptly. Moreover, the opposing boule that has been shifted by previous impacts with the stones often ends up in a position more exposed to the rafle than to the airborne shot. → Systematic advantage on: stony ground, uneven ground in general 3 The experienced player — the library of difficult grounds A player who has played hundreds of competitions on varied grounds has developed a mental library of ground behaviors. Faced with a cross-slope ground, they have already seen this behavior and intuitively know which compensation to apply — without needing two ends of observation. This pattern recognition is a tacit skill that is not learned from a book but from repeated experience. On a perfect ground, experience advantages little. On a difficult ground, it is decisive. → Systematic advantage on: all difficult grounds compared to less experienced players 4 The player with strong mental resilience — the nastiness does not destabilize them Difficult grounds generate frustration — well-thrown boules that deviate, unpredictable results, a sense of injustice. Players with a low tolerance for frustration see their level drop on a difficult ground — their throwing motion tightens up, their decisions get rushed. Players with high mental resilience maintain their quality of play in the same conditions. This psychological gap creates a real advantage, independent of the initial technical level. → Systematic advantage on: all difficult grounds, particularly in the final ends of a tense competition 5 The "conservative" player — less exposure to hazards A player who plays a conservative game — close and safe points, shots only when the target is well exposed — takes fewer risks and is therefore less exposed to the ground's hazards. An "aggressive" player who attempts difficult shots at 8 meters on a stony ground multiplies their exposures to disturbers. On a tricky ground, a conservative strategy rewards more than an aggressive strategy — the hazards penalize aggressiveness more than caution. → Systematic advantage on: grounds with strong hazards (stones, bumps, irregularities), compared to aggressive styles 6 The ambidextrous player — access to all angles on a slope On a cross-slope ground, certain angles of attack are naturally better than others. A player who can point with both hands chooses the optimal angle according to the configuration — they can always play "with the slope" rather than "against the slope". The one-handed player is limited to the angle of their dominant hand and must correct for the slope by aiming compensation — less precise and less natural than simply changing the angle of attack. → Systematic advantage on: grounds with a significant cross-slope 7 The local player — knowledge of the specific difficult ground Playing on your usual ground — even a horrible ground — represents a considerable structural advantage. The cross-slope at the 7th meter, the stone that deflects left at 5 meters, the soft zone in the first third of the ground — the home team knows them by heart and has automatic compensations. The opposing team discovers them in real time. This information advantage is particularly strong on tricky grounds: the more difficult the ground, the more prior knowledge is worth. → Systematic advantage on: all home competitions on a specific difficult ground

Concrete scenarios — who wins on which ground

⛰️ Steep-slope ground — powerful shooter vs technical pointer LOFTED POINTER ADVANTAGE

Two teams face off on a ground with a 5–6% cross-slope. The first team relies on a dominant shooter who usually wins the ends through shooting. The second has a technical lofted pointer who creates stable boules close to the jack.

On this ground: the lofted pointer places their boules cleanly, compensating for the slope with an offset axis. The shooter must also correct the axis at the moment of the shot — and the opposing boule is in a zone influenced by the slope. Every missed shot leaves the opposing pointer's boule holding the point, and the slope can shift the boules after impact.

ANALYSIS The slope reduces the effectiveness of offensive shooting play (post-impact unpredictability) and advantages precision lofted-point play (less interaction with the ground). The team with stable points is objectively advantaged on a sloping ground. 🪨 Stony ground — two teams of equal level, different techniques RAFLE SHOOTER AND LOFTED POINTER ADVANTAGE

Two teams of comparable theoretical level. One plays mainly rolled points and direct-hit shooting. The other consists of a lofted pointer and a shooter who often uses the rafle. On a perfect ground, the performances would be similar.

On a stony ground: the rolled points of the first team deviate on every stone crossed. Their direct-hit shots bounce unpredictably. The opposing team: the lofted points pass over the stones, the rafles navigate them. At an equivalent technical level, the second team wins on this ground.

ANALYSIS This scenario perfectly illustrates the structural advantage of technique. On a stony terrain, a technically inferior player with the right technique can beat a superior player with the wrong one — because the terrain drags bad technique down and amplifies good technique. 💧 Muddy terrain — beginner vs expert EXPERT ADVANTAGE AMPLIFIED

A seasoned player with 15 years of experience plays against a good-level but less experienced player. On a perfect terrain, the gap between them is real but not huge. They play on waterlogged terrain after morning rain.

The seasoned player has played on many muddy terrains. He immediately knows that the force must be increased by 20–30%, that the jack sinks into the ground and must be aimed at directly, and that the boule must not be damp. He applies these corrections from the very first end. His opponent discovers these effects gradually — he reaches the same conclusion in the third end, but with 2 ends lost along the way.

ANALYSIS A difficult terrain amplifies the skill gap between players of different experience. On a perfect terrain, an intermediate player compensates with his technique. On a muddy terrain, it is the mental library of experience that decides — and there, the expert is unbeatable. 🏗️ Concrete — calm player vs easily frustrated player PSYCHOLOGICAL ADVANTAGE

Two players of identical technical level play on a concrete surface. The first is known for his composure — unexpected bounces don't faze him. The second is more emotional — unpredictable results irritate him and affect his technique.

On concrete, the bounces are strong and sometimes spectacular. Both players miss boules they would have made on clay. But the difference: the first absorbs the misses without affecting his next throw. The second gradually tenses up — his throws become less fluid, his decisions more hasty. From the 5th end onward, the gap in results widens.

ANALYSIS When two players of equivalent technical level find themselves on a difficult terrain, it is psychological resilience that decides. A tricky terrain is an amplifier of mental differences — it creates the conditions for emotional breakdown in less stable players.

The psychological dimension — why it is half the battle

🧠 Threat as a disruptive factor

A tricky terrain creates a threat of unpredictable result — the boules can deviate at any moment. This permanent threat generates an additional mental load that degrades concentration. Players accustomed to difficult terrains have learned to switch off this mental threat.

🎯 Attribution of failures

When a boule deviates off a stone, the player must decide: is it my technique or the terrain? A player who systematically attributes deviations to his own technique tries to correct something that isn't broken. A player who correctly identifies the external cause changes nothing about his technique — he adjusts his line.

⚡ Frustration as a cascade

The frustration from a boule deviated by the terrain can contaminate the next boule through tension. This frustration cascade — one miss leads to another miss through degraded technique — is well documented in sports psychology. Experienced players break it after each boule.

🌊 The terrain as a preemptive excuse

Some players unconsciously use the difficult terrain as a preemptive excuse — "if I miss, it's the terrain". This ego protection shields them from the feeling of failure but defuses the motivation to adapt their game. The opponent who refuses this mental way out adapts better.

🏆 The "I'm in control" effect

The player who has identified an effective compensation on a difficult terrain feels a sense of mastery — "I've figured out this terrain". This feeling has a positive effect on confidence and the accuracy of subsequent throws. It is the exact opposite of the frustration spiral.

🔄 Variability as training

Players who have regularly played on varied and difficult terrains have developed a tolerance for variability — their technique is robust because it was forged in instability. A technique trained only on a perfect terrain is fragile when faced with the unexpected.

Using a tricky ground deliberately

If you are the player or team that benefits from a tricky terrain — whether through your technique or your knowledge of the terrain — how do you make the most of it?

♟️ ADVANCED STRATEGY Maximizing your advantage on a known tricky terrain 1. Place the jack in the zones that amplify your advantage. If you have an excellent lob pointer and the terrain is stony, place the jack in the stoniest zone of the terrain. Your boules will fly over them. Theirs will roll into them.

2. Don't reveal your compensations. When you compensate for the slope or the stones, do it discreetly. If the opponent notices that you systematically aim to the right of the jack on this terrain, he can copy your compensation. Keeping your adjustments to yourself is a form of informational advantage.

3. Vary the placement of the jack to use several tricky zones. If your terrain has a slope on the left side AND stones on the right side, alternating between the two zones forces the opponent to recalibrate his compensations constantly — which increases his mental load and his error rate.

Ethical limit: exploiting a difficult terrain that you know is legitimate tactics. Deliberately worsening a terrain to make it unplayable (smashing stones into shards, digging holes) would be contrary to the spirit of the game — and above all to the rules. 📖 PAQUITA'S BOOK Technique, terrain and psychology — the complete trio

Is it ethical to deliberately exploit difficult terrain against a less experienced opponent? + Yes — exploiting the conditions in which we play is legitimate sports tactics, not cheating. A tennis team that chooses to play on clay because it is better there is not cheating. In pétanque, placing the jack in a difficult area that you know better than the opponent is a valid tactical decision. The only limit: deliberately modifying the state of the ground (adding stones, digging the ground) would be against the rules. Using the land as it is, including its defects, is perfectly regular. Is the lifted point always greater than the rolled point on difficult terrain? + On irregular terrain (rocks, bumps, roots), yes — the point raised is systematically superior because it minimizes contact with irregularities. There is one notable exception: on concrete or a very hard surface, the raised point suffers from the strong post-give rebound. In this case, it is the rolled point (very grazing angle, trajectory at ground level) which performs better — the ball "grazes" the surface without significant bounce. The general conclusion remains that the pointer who masters both techniques (lifting AND rolling) adapts to all terrain, where the specialist in only one is limited. How to develop psychological resilience in the face of difficult terrain? + Three concrete approaches. 1) Progressive exposure : deliberately training on difficult and irregular terrains. Tolerance for variability develops through repeated exposure — each session on a difficult terrain raises your frustration trigger threshold. 2) Mental reframing : after each boule deviated by the terrain, say mentally (or in a low voice) "information about the terrain" rather than "miss". This reframing changes the causal attribution of failure and prevents the frustration cascade. 3) Reset routine : a micro-routine between each ball (breathing, hand gesture, looking towards a fixed point) allows you to erase the emotional state of the previous ball before throwing the next one. Should federations impose minimum standards for field quality in competitions? + The FFPJP and the FIPJP define minimum criteria for approved fields used in major official competitions (French championships, international competitions) — particularly on dimensions, the absence of dangerous obstacles and visibility. For club competitions and local tournaments, the requirements are much more relaxed. This is deliberate: pétanque is historically an outdoor game that is suitable for all terrains. Imposing it on controlled surfaces only would fundamentally change the nature of the game and would remove precisely this dimension of adaptability which enriches the competition.
